What Makes Nekeptas Tortas So Special
The biggest advantage of a nekeptas tortas is that it does not require traditional baking. Instead of relying on an oven to create a cake structure, these desserts often use cookies, biscuits, crackers, nuts, cream, condensed milk, yogurt, chocolate, or fruit. The ingredients are layered or combined and then chilled until the dessert becomes firm enough to slice.
This method makes these cakes accessible even to beginners. There is no need to worry about whether a sponge cake has risen correctly or whether the oven temperature is accurate. Most of the work involves mixing, layering, decorating, and allowing enough time for the dessert to set.
Another benefit is versatility. A basic recipe can become completely different by changing the cookies, filling, fruit, or topping. This makes nekeptas tortas an excellent choice for experimenting with new flavors.
Classic Cookie and Cream Cake
One of the easiest ideas is a cookie-and-cream version. Start with plain tea biscuits or another favorite crisp cookie. Prepare a creamy filling using whipped cream, cream cheese, sour cream, or sweetened condensed milk, depending on the flavor and consistency you prefer.
Layer crushed or whole cookies with the cream mixture in a cake dish. Continue creating layers until the ingredients are used. The final layer can be covered with cream and decorated with cookie crumbs or grated chocolate.
Refrigeration is essential because the cookies gradually soften and absorb moisture from the filling. After several hours, they develop a cake-like texture that is easy to cut and pleasantly tender.
Chocolate Nekeptas Tortas for Chocolate Lovers
Chocolate is one of the easiest ways to make a no-bake dessert feel indulgent. For a rich chocolate nekeptas tortas, combine chocolate cookies with a creamy chocolate filling. Melted dark or milk chocolate can be incorporated into the cream, while cocoa powder can add deeper flavor.
For additional texture, add chopped hazelnuts, almonds, walnuts, or chocolate pieces between the layers. A thin chocolate glaze on top creates a smooth finish and makes the dessert look suitable for special occasions.
For a more balanced flavor, consider using dark chocolate and adding fresh berries. Raspberries, strawberries, and cherries provide a pleasant contrast to the sweetness of the chocolate.
Fresh Fruit Layered Dessert
Fruit can make a no-bake cake lighter and more refreshing. Strawberries, blueberries, raspberries, peaches, bananas, and mangoes can all work well when paired with a creamy filling.
For example, create layers of biscuits, vanilla cream, and sliced strawberries. Repeat the layers and finish with fresh fruit on top. If using bananas, a small amount of lemon juice can help reduce browning.
For an especially fresh result, use a yogurt-based filling instead of a very heavy cream. Greek-style yogurt combined with whipped cream and a little honey can provide a creamy but refreshing layer.
Caramel and Biscuit Combination
Caramel lovers can create a wonderfully rich nekeptas tortas using biscuits, caramel, and cream. A simple filling can combine whipped cream with caramel sauce or dulce de leche.
Arrange a layer of biscuits in a dish, spread over some caramel cream, and repeat the process. Add a thin layer of caramel on top before chilling. Chopped nuts can be sprinkled over the surface for extra crunch.
Because caramel desserts can become quite sweet, unsweetened cream or a pinch of salt can help create better balance.
Coffee-Flavored No-Bake Cake
Coffee is another excellent ingredient for a sophisticated dessert. Dip plain biscuits briefly in cooled coffee before layering them with a mascarpone or cream-based filling. Avoid soaking the biscuits for too long because they can become difficult to handle.
For extra flavor, add cocoa powder between the layers or dust it over the finished cake. A coffee-flavored nekeptas tortas is particularly appealing to adults who enjoy desserts with a less fruity and more aromatic character.
Nutty Nekeptas Tortas
Nuts can transform a simple no-bake cake by adding crunch and depth. Walnuts, hazelnuts, almonds, pistachios, and pecans are all useful choices.
Try combining crushed biscuits with chopped nuts before layering them with a creamy filling. Toasting the nuts lightly before using them can enhance their natural aroma. For an elegant finish, decorate the top with whole nuts, chocolate curls, or a light dusting of cocoa.
The combination of creamy and crunchy textures keeps every bite interesting.
Cheesecake-Inspired Version
A cheesecake-style nekeptas tortas is another popular idea. Instead of baking a traditional cheesecake base, create a crust from crushed biscuits mixed with melted butter. Press the mixture firmly into a cake pan or springform pan.
For the filling, combine cream cheese with whipped cream and a sweetener. Vanilla, lemon zest, or fruit puree can be added for extra flavor. Some recipes use gelatin to help the filling become firm, while others rely on refrigeration and thick cream cheese.
Once assembled, refrigerate the cake until completely set. Fresh berries or fruit sauce can provide a colorful topping.
Tips for Getting the Best Texture
Although no-bake cakes are simple, a few details can make a major difference. First, choose ingredients with complementary textures. Crisp cookies work well because they soften gradually when exposed to moisture.
Second, avoid making the cream too thin. A filling that is excessively runny may cause the layers to collapse. If necessary, use thicker cream cheese, whipped cream, yogurt, or another stabilizing ingredient.
Chilling time is equally important. Most no-bake cakes benefit from several hours in the refrigerator, while some are even better when left overnight. This gives the layers enough time to blend and the biscuits enough time to soften.
Decorating Your No-Bake Dessert
Presentation can turn a simple nekeptas tortas into an impressive centerpiece. Fresh berries, grated chocolate, cookie crumbs, chopped nuts, coconut flakes, caramel drizzle, or cocoa powder can all be used for decoration.
For birthdays and celebrations, pipe small cream rosettes around the edges and arrange colorful fruit in the center. For a minimalist look, simply dust the top with cocoa or powdered sugar and add a few chocolate curls.
Remember that decoration should complement the flavor rather than overwhelm it. A fruit-based cake benefits from fresh fruit, while a chocolate cake can be finished with chocolate or nuts.
Making Nekeptas Tortas Ahead of Time
One of the greatest conveniences of a no-bake cake is that it can usually be prepared in advance. Making it the day before serving allows the flavors to develop and gives the dessert plenty of time to achieve the right consistency.
Keep the cake refrigerated in a covered container or under suitable food-safe covering. If you are using fresh fruit, particularly fruit with a high water content, consider adding it shortly before serving to maintain the best appearance and texture.
